Whipping Up Homemade Banana Bread from Scratch

There's nothing quite like the smell of fresh-baked banana bread wafting through your home. And making it on your own is easier than you might think! Start by gathering your ingredients. You'll need ripe bananas, of course, as well as all-purpose flour, sugar, eggs, butter, and a pinch of cinnamon. Once you have everything ready, simply blend the ingredients according to your favorite recipe.

Then, pour the batter into a loaf pan and cook until gol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Let it cool completely before slicing and enjoying your delicious homemade banana bread.
